In-depth review: ContentQuiver
ContentQuiver occupies a narrow but genuinely useful slot in the AI content repurposing space: it is built specifically to turn newsletter PDFs into social media posts. Unlike broader repurposing tools that try to handle blog posts, videos, or podcasts, ContentQuiver focuses on one input format and one output goal. That focus gives it a clear identity, but it also means the tool is only as valuable as your newsletter habit. If you publish a newsletter regularly and want to extend its reach beyond the inbox without manually rewriting each issue for Twitter, Reddit, or LinkedIn, ContentQuiver offers a streamlined pipeline. The workflow is simple: upload a newsletter PDF, let the AI read it, then tweak the generated posts for each platform. The tool claims to learn your voice over time, which could make subsequent repurposing faster and more consistent. However, the current feature set is a mix of what works now and what is promised. Automated social posting, a key selling point for true automation, is listed as coming soon. Until that is live, you still need to manually copy and paste or schedule the posts yourself, which reduces the time-saving benefit. Platform support is also limited at launch to Twitter and Reddit, with LinkedIn, Facebook, and Instagram on the roadmap. For a social media manager juggling multiple channels, that limitation matters. The free tier offers a taste: two credits per month for one newsletter instance, supporting only Twitter and Reddit. The Pro plan at $29 per month unlocks 100 credits, unlimited newsletter instances, and priority support, but the credit system means each generation consumes a credit, so heavy users need to plan accordingly. Voice learning is a standout feature in theory, but its practical effectiveness depends on how much content you feed it. The tool's best use case is for solo creators who publish a weekly newsletter and want to maintain a presence on Twitter and Reddit without extra effort. For email marketers, it provides a way to amplify key insights beyond the inbox. Small business owners with limited time might find the free tier useful for testing, but the lack of auto-posting and limited platforms may push them toward more mature tools. The company offers a discount for nonprofits and educational institutions, which is a nice touch. Overall, ContentQuiver is a promising niche tool that is still maturing. Buyers should evaluate it based on their current platform needs and willingness to work around the missing automation. If you are a newsletter creator active on Twitter and Reddit, it is worth a trial. If you need LinkedIn or Instagram support now, or expect full automation, wait for updates.

Frequently asked questions
How does ContentQuiver's free plan compare to the Pro plan?Pricing
The free plan allows repurposing one newsletter per month (2 credits) for Twitter and Reddit only. The Pro plan at $29/month includes unlimited newsletters, 100 credits, support for more platforms (LinkedIn, Facebook, Instagram coming soon), advanced AI with voice learning, and priority support. The free plan is good for testing, but active users will likely need Pro.
Which social media platforms are currently supported?Integration
Currently, ContentQuiver supports Twitter and Reddit. LinkedIn, Facebook, Instagram, and more are listed as coming soon. The Pro plan mentions support for multiple platforms, but only Twitter and Reddit are confirmed available at launch.
Can I upload any PDF newsletter, or are there format restrictions?Workflow
You can upload any PDF newsletter. The AI reads the content and repurposes it. However, heavily formatted PDFs with complex layouts may affect extraction accuracy. Plain text or simple layouts work best.
How does the voice learning technology work?General
Voice learning technology analyzes your writing style from uploaded newsletters to mimic your tone, vocabulary, and structure in repurposed posts. It improves over time as you provide more content. This helps maintain a consistent brand voice across platforms.
Is there a limit on how many newsletters I can repurpose per month?Limitations
Yes, the free plan allows repurposing one newsletter per month (2 credits). The Pro plan offers 100 generation credits per month, which typically covers multiple newsletters depending on how many posts you generate per newsletter. There is no limit on newsletter instances in Pro.
